Reinventing Axl Rose is Against Me!'s first full length album. It was released on No Idea Records, fronted by band member Tom Gabel. This is the first Against Me! release with a full band, including electric guitar and a full drum kit. The album's cryptic title appears to be in reference to the growing culture of corporate rock, and more specifically the "comeback" concerts cancelled that year (2001) by Guns N' Roses lead singer, Axl Rose. The album contains many songs that were previously unreleased, such as "The Politics of Starving", and several old fan favorites, such as "Walking Is Still Honest" and "Jordan's First Choice". The album's title track is a stirring anthem of DIY Anarcho-punk values and dreams. "I Still Love You Julie" first appeared on Crime As Forgiven By. "Walking is Still Honest" first appeared on the Against Me! EP. "Pints of Guinness Make You Strong", "Those Anarcho Punks are Mysterious...", "Jordan's First Choice" and "Reinventing Axl Rose" first appeared on The Acoustic EP.
